Transaction 52f024eaf69a40d55520cfd0bcea1cd29bd2994bacb2f982a67aa6263918f4ba

1 Input
2 Outputs
  • 52f024eaf69a40d55520cfd0bcea1cd29bd2994bacb2f982a67aa6263918f4ba:0
  • value  7600000
    address  17keTZvLU62Z7Zgv26zehrXqbHHQWE5fAA
  • 52f024eaf69a40d55520cfd0bcea1cd29bd2994bacb2f982a67aa6263918f4ba:1
  • value  7361931682
    address  1Fj63JEVvmTMum1EBeBAeTfv2G1zDq4fn5